    Is their away i can save my favorite from windows 32 and put it in windows 64bit?

    I have Windows 7 Home Premium 32bit and I having a friend build me a New Rig and I am getting Windows 7 Home Premium 64bit and I was wondering is their a way the i can save my favorites In the 32bit to move to 64bit. Without having to write them all down?

    Re: Is their away i can save my favorite from windows 32 and put it in windows 64bit?

    You should be able to export your favorites to a file in order to easily transfer them (by importing them) to another computer.
    The attachment was produced from the help section within IE9 most browsers have similar if not identical utilities.
